Method
Preparation
- 1
Cut the Potatoes
Wash and peel the russet potatoes. Cut them into thick strips (approximately 1/2 inch wide) to create hand-cut fries.
- 2
Soak the Fries
Place the cut fries in a large bowl of cold water and let them soak for at least 30 minutes. This helps to remove excess starch and makes the fries crispier.
- 3
Dry the Fries
Drain the soaked fries and pat them dry with paper towels to remove any excess moisture.
- 4
Heat the Oil
In a large pot or deep fryer, heat vegetable oil to 350°F (175°C). Make sure there's enough oil to fully submerge the fries.
- 5
Fry the Potatoes
Carefully add a handful of fries to the hot oil and fry them in batches. Fry for about 5-7 minutes or until they are golden brown and crispy.
- 6
Drain and Season
Use a slotted spoon to remove the fries from the oil and let them drain on paper towels. While still hot, season with salt, black pepper, garlic powder, and paprika to taste.
- 7
Serve
Serve the fries hot, either on their own or with your favorite dipping sauce.
